There’s almost a full minute of silence after I ask Chris Walla my first question. It’s the kind of silence usually reserved for bad phone connections, an accidentally activated mute button or one person delivering an oblivious line of Michael Scott proportions. So after a few beats I ask Chris Walla if he’s still on the other line, and he is. He’s thinking.

The former DCFC guitarist talks with us about his new instrumental solo album and his feelings about leaving the band.
After 17 years in Death Cab For Cutie, Walla has a solo album full of ambient, hand-crafted, subtly enveloping instrumental music.

Almost exactly one year ago, Death Cab for Cutie's founding guitarist and producer Chris Walla announced that Kintsugi would be his last with the band. Here we are pleased to announce that Walla is returning this fall with a solo album, Tape Loops, and premiere the first single,
